New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Create Power Automate Flows that Dynamically Support Different Companies

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The tenth of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is Create Power Automate flows that dynamically support different companies.

Building Power Automate flows that are easily portable and work with multiple companies helps partners and consultants use Power Platform when adapting Business Central to the needs of small and medium-sized businesses.

Enabled for: Admins, makers, marketers, or analysts, automatically
Public Preview: Sep 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

This feature provides the following capabilities to Power Automate makers as they create or edit flows:

  • Access to a list of API categories and APIs/tables in all actions—without even specifying a company.
  • Edit the corresponding flow steps with all metadata details even though no company was provided.
  • Use of Dataverse environment variables for environments and companies.
  • Support for application lifecycle management (ALM) with Dataverse environment variables in AL-Go for GitHub.
  • Use a standard variable for company ID and make flows that can run in the context of different companies.
  • Use the output of the new List Companies action to perform actions or read data across companies.

I need to do some exploring of the new features outlined above, but on the surface they sound like they will be very useful.

The first item, access to the list of API categories and tables without selecting a company will resolve an irritation, where at present you have to explicitly select the environment and company to see the lists. This is annoying for a flow which could be run against any company, meaning you need to pick the environment and company to select from the API and then remove them and set back to the variables. This change means this won’t need to be done.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Simplified Power Automate Approval Flow Experience

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The ninth of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is Simplified Power Automate approval flow experience.

Approving documents or data changes in a modern company must be straightforward. Microsoft listen to feedback and continue to improve this area, making sure this experience matches business users’ expectations.

Enabled for: Users, automatically
Public Preview: Sep 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

In the previous release, Microsoft have introduced several new templates and a simplified approval experience based on Power Automate. With this wave, Microsoft have improved this area by introducing several new changes:

  • Microsoft automatically set the environment and company in approval templates so that the user doesn’t need to choose those every time.
  • Microsoft have added the requestor to the request for approval and confirmation emails, making it clear who requested and who approved the change.
  • The Approval step in Microsoft’s templates now includes “Requested by” to indicate the proper requestor.
  • Correctly handle the “cancel approval request” decision on the Power Automate side.
  • An optional adaptive card can be posted to a chosen Teams channel (or user) with information that a given document was approved.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Get List of Companies Using Business Central Connector in Power Automate

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The eighth of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is Get list of companies using Business Central connector in Power Automate.

More often, customers and partners are trying to instrument workflows working across companies in Business Central, but they’re blocked. Having an action in the Business Central connector that retrieves a list of companies in Business Central unblocks these customers and partners, providing greater flexibility for executing flows across multiple companies.

Enabled for: Admins, makers, marketers, or analysts, automatically
Public Preview: Sep 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

With this new action in a workflow, you can get all Business Central companies available in a given environment and then either iterate through them all or find a specific one.

This capability enables the creation of more dynamic workflows that function seamlessly across different companies.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Consolidated Power Automate Flow Creation from Business Central Templates

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The seventh of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is Consolidated Power Automate flow creation from Business Central templates.

It’s essential that all Power Automate integration capabilities and sample templates are clearly defined, marked, and visible in the product so that decision makers can use them effectively when needed.

Enabled for: Admins, makers, marketers, or analysts, automatically
Public Preview: Sep 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

This feature in Business Central provides advanced users with a single entry point to create flows based on templates. New actions have been added to enable flow creation in the following categories:

  • Defining an approval request workflow if the page supports it. This was previously available as an application action but was difficult to find.
  • Creating an automated background flow (for instance, flows based on external business events). Prior to this addition, such automations were only possible in Power Automate, and there were no Business Central templates supporting them.
  • Creating a manual or instant flow. While this capability existed before, several new templates have been added to expand its functionality.

Microsoft also added several new automated and instant flow templates to their gallery.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Support Business Events in Business Central Connector for Power Automate

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The second of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is support business events in Business Central connector for Power Automate.

During 2023 release wave 1, the new external business events feature was introduced as a preview in the platform, enabling robust and extendable integration scenarios. Adding the same capability directly to the Business Central connector opens up more possibilities for Power Automate flows and Azure Logic Apps to react on events precisely when and how the developer intended.

Enabled for: Admins, makers, marketers, or analysts, automatically
Public Preview: Jul 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

With this release, building flows that react to specific business events in Business Central (version 22.2 and later) is now possible. This feature enables users and makers to hook flows to specific business events raised by Business Central (version 22.2 and later), or even events built by partners who added business event code into their applications.

To support this functionality, we’ve added a Business Central connector trigger called When a business event occurs (preview). The trigger has the following characteristics:

  • It immediately reacts to any business event raised in a selected environment.
  • It reacts to events in a specific named company or in any company in that environment.
  • It provides the creator with more context to build the flow logic upon, like environment, company ID and company name, initiating user ID (which is the Azure AD user ID), and everything included in the specific business event payload.
  • It reacts on multiple events at once, even in parallel, letting Power Automate deal with concurrency.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2: Change Modification Limits for Triggering Flows and Bulk Updates

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 2.

The first of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Power Platform section is change modification limits for triggering flows and bulk updates.

Processing large datasets in Power Automate or triggering automation when multiple rows have been updated works smoothly, even for larger updates.

Enabled for: Admins, makers, marketers, or analysts, automatically
Public Preview: Jul 2023
General Availability: Oct 2023

Feature Details

Until now, there was a limit of 100 rows in the way that Power Automate flows and Dataverse virtual tables were triggered when multiple rows were changed during a short period of time. This limit may have caused your Power Automate flows to stop reacting to certain rapid changes in data. We’ve now changed the limit from 100 to 1,000, opening up for more advanced scenarios.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1: Use Power Automate To Post Adaptive Card Or Link To Business Central Record

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1.

The sixth of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Microsoft Power Platform section is Use Power Automate To Post Adaptive Card Or Link To Business Central Record.

Being able to blend Power Automate flows into conversations in Microsoft Teams allows for enriching conversations with useful insights.

Enabled for: Users, automatically
Public Preview: Apr 2023
General Availability: Jun 2023

Feature Details

Microsoft have introduced two new actions in the Business Central connector for Power Automate, which are only avaiable in the cloud offering:

Get URL

  • Generates a web client URL to a record.
  • Requires standard parameters like environment, company, system ID, and the ID of the page that will be referenced in the URL.
  • The generated URL can be used with the Get Adaptive Card action described in the next section.
  • Enables scenarios in products such as Outlook and Teams where a clickable URL to a specific record in Business Central is needed. For example, you want to send an email to a colleague with actionable information and a link to a Business Central record.

Get Adaptive Card

  • Creates an adaptive card for a provided URL. The card is delivered as a payload to be used with a Teams connector or elsewhere.
  • Reuses the adaptive card layout, content, and customizations known from the main product.
  • Respects the user permissions while accessing card details.
  • Enables more scenarios for integration with Teams where a rich card displaying a Business Central record is needed. For example, you want to post information and a link to a new sales order to an internal Teams channel.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1: Remove Modification Limits For Triggering Flows

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1.

The fifth of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Microsoft Power Platform section is Remove Modification Limits For Triggering Flows.

Processing large datasets in Power Automate or triggering automation when multiple rows have been updated works smoothly, regardless of a business’s size. Removing limitations was the idea behind this feature.

Enabled for: Users, automatically
Public Preview: Apr 2023
General Availability: Jun 2023

Feature Details

Until now, there were limits to the way that Power Automate flows and Dataverse Virtual Tables were triggered when multiple rows were changed during a short period of time. Microsoft have removed those limits, and updated the way the Power Automate connector communicates with the Business Central API layer to open up for more advanced scenarios.

New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1: New Approval Workflow Experience With Power Automate Templates

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business CentralThis post is part of the New Functionality In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1 series in which I am taking a look at the new functionality introduced in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central 2023 Wave 1.

The third of the new functionality in the Adapt faster with Microsoft Power Platform section is New Approval Workflow Experience With Power Automate Templates.

Advanced and flexible approval workflows don’t need to be complex. Business owners or decision makers can choose from multiple templates when they set up approval workflows in Business Central.

Enabled for: Users, automatically
Public Preview: Mar 2023
General Availability: Apr 2023

Feature Details

Business Central online customers who use Power Automate to run document approval workflows are able to do so easily with this release. Several actions linked to workflow approvals and Power Automate have been improved with additional support for selecting one of many templates for each document type. Users and decisions makers can use Power Automate to run approval and take advantage of the rich experience:

  • Define workflows tied to a selected Business Central environment and company.
  • Approve documents using mobile devices.
  • Approve documents using Microsoft Teams.
  • Support a chain of approvers and additional input.
